Santo Domingo Merengue Festival 2011
Festival del Merengue Santo Domingo 2011 time is upon us again. This is the 44th annual festival on the Malecon (Avenida George Washington)in Santo Domingo. July, 29, 30, and 31 is when all the fun and music happens. The Ministry of Tourism has announced that the 2011 Merengue Festival will be celebrated 29-31 July at […]
